Michal Szczecinski 538db6e881 shape: added duplicate api.
Changes:
1. New shape->duplicate(Shape) api.
2. New example: testDuplicate
3. Added capi binding for duploicate api
4. Added capi duplication test in testCapi.c

Description:

Added implementation of duplicate api. For now it supports stroke
properties and shape properties (fill color, path) duplication.

TODO:
Implement gradient properties duplication

#include "tvgSceneImpl.h"
/************************************************************************/
/* External Class Implementation */
/************************************************************************/
Scene::Scene() : pImpl(make_unique<Impl>())
{
Paint::IMPL->method(new PaintMethod<Scene::Impl>(IMPL));
}
Scene::~Scene()
{
}
unique_ptr<Scene> Scene::gen() noexcept
{
return unique_ptr<Scene>(new Scene);
}
Result Scene::push(unique_ptr<Paint> paint) noexcept
{
auto p = paint.release();
if (!p) return Result::MemoryCorruption;
IMPL->paints.push_back(p);
return Result::Success;
}
Result Scene::reserve(uint32_t size) noexcept
{
IMPL->paints.reserve(size);
return Result::Success;
}
std::unique_ptr<Paint> Scene::duplicate() const noexcept
{
//TODO: implement
return nullptr;
}
